FAQS 4

What is the difference between positive pressure and negative pressure filtration?

There is no adverse pressure difference across the feeding device in a negative-pressure system and so multiple point feeding of materials into a common line presents few problems. In comparison with a positive-pressure system, however, the filtration plant has to be much larger, as a higher volume of air has to be filtered under vacuum conditions.

What is a negative pressure system?

Negative pressure systems are defined as systems that transport products using air at pressures lower than atmospheric pressure, typically for moving solids from multiple sources to a single hopper. How useful is this definition? You might find these chapters and articles relevant to this topic.

What are the advantages and disadvantages of a negative pressure system?

A particular advantage of negative-pressure systems, whether open or closed, in terms of potentially hazardous materials, is that should a pipeline coupling be inadvertently left untightened, or a bend in the pipeline fail, air will be drawn into a system maintained under vacuum.

How does a negative pressure filtration system work?

With negative-pressure systems the entire discharge system operates under vacuum, and this includes the filtration plant. Filters are generally sized in terms of the surface area of filter cloth, and the surface area required is evaluated in terms of a given air velocity across the fabric surface.
